Fiat Chrysler launching car-sharing service using Jeep brand

Fiat Chrysler is preparing to launch a three-month car-sharing trial for North American Jeep owners, as part of a partnership with Avis. According to reporting in The Detroit News, the company is partnering with Avis Budget Group on a three-month subscription service, allowing owners to swap their cars for other vehicles in the FCA umbrella.
